What Is the Human Microbiome? An Overview:
Definition and Composition of the Microbiome:
The microbiome is a community of trillions of microorganisms that live inside and on the body. Think of it as an invisible army made up of bacteria, fungi, viruses, and protozoa. These tiny creatures find their home in your gut, skin, mouth, and other areas. Each part of your body hosts its own specialized microbiome, each with different types of microbes that serve different roles.
Where Microbiomes Reside in the Body:
Main spots where microbiomes thrive include the gut, skin, mouth, respiratory system, and urogenital area. The gut microbiome is the most studied because it affects digestion and immune health. Meanwhile, skin microbes help protect against harmful invaders on your body’s surface. The mouth and respiratory passages play a role in fighting infections before they reach deeper inside. Every location has its own unique mix that influences overall well-being.
How the Microbiome Develops and Changes Over Time:
Your microbiome begins forming at birth, influenced by how you’re born, cesarean or vaginal delivery. Early childhood days help shape the microbial community as your diet, environment, and health factors come into play. As you grow, your microbiome continues evolving, affected by things like what you eat, antibiotics, stress, and exposure to nature. While it can change, maintaining a diverse microbiome is essential to good health.
The Protective Roles of the Microbiome in Your Health:
Immune System Modulation:
Your microbiome trains your immune system to tell friend from foe. It helps regulate how your body fights infections and prevents it from attacking itself. For example, gut bacteria play a big role in preventing autoimmune diseases, where the immune system hits your own tissues. When microbes are balanced, your immune response works just right, strong but not overreacting.
Barrier Function and Prevention of Pathogens:
The microbiome acts like a barrier in your body’s front lines. It helps keep mucous membranes, like those in your gut or mouth, strong and intact. Beneficial microbes outcompete harmful germs, preventing them from settling in and causing trouble. It’s like a group of friendly neighbors keeping unwelcome visitors out.
Production of Essential Nutrients and Metabolites:
Microbes aren’t just protectors, they’re also producers. They make vitamins such as K and B vitamins that your body needs. They also produce short-chain fatty acids (SCFAs), which fuel your cells and reduce inflammation. These compounds play a crucial part in overall health, and without them, your body would struggle to stay in balance.
How a Healthy Microbiome Prevents Disease:
Gut Microbiome and Digestive Health:
When your gut microbiome is healthy, digestion runs smoothly. But when imbalance occurs, called dysbiosis, it can lead to issues like irritable bowel syndrome (IBS) and inflammatory bowel disease (IBD). Studies show that restoring balance can sometimes cure or improve these conditions. This highlights how vital a diverse microbiome is for digestion.
Microbiome and Chronic Diseases:
Dysbiosis isn’t just about digestion; it can shape your risk for obesity, diabetes, and heart disease. Bad bacteria can promote inflammation and insulin resistance. Some new research even links gut bacteria to mental health, thanks to what’s called the gut-brain axis. The idea: a happy microbiome supports a healthy mind and body.
Microbiome and Infection Resistance:
A resilient microbiome can protect you from tough infections like Clostridioides difficile. When your good bacteria are plentiful, they fight off harmful bacteria. Doctors now use probiotics, live beneficial microbes, and even fecal transplants to restore balance when infections strike.
Supporting and Maintaining a Healthy Microbiome:
Dietary Strategies:
Feeding your microbes is a smart move. Eating plenty of fiber-rich foods, like fruits, vegetables, and whole grains, acts as prebiotics that nourish beneficial bacteria. Fermented foods like yogurt, sauerkraut, and kefir supply probiotics directly. These foods help keep your microbiome thriving.
Lifestyle Factors:
Avoid unnecessary use of antibiotics, which can wipe out good microbes along with bad. Regular exercise and managing stress also support a diverse microbiome. Think of it as giving your tiny allies the best environment to flourish.
Emerging Technologies and Future Directions:
Scientists are using advanced microbiome sequencing to understand individual differences better. This research is paving the way for personalized treatments that target your unique microbial makeup. Soon, we might see tailored probiotic therapies and microbiome-based medicines become common.
